Lompat ke konten Lompat ke sidebar Lompat ke footer

Tutorial Cara Membuat Print Preview PHP & Mysql Pada MasterCSS

Kali ini saya akan membagikan sebuah tutorial bagaimana caranya membuat print preview menggunakan php. berikut ini adalah contoh source code nya. silahkan dicoba dan dikembangkan dan semoga ilmunya bisa bermanfaat.







<style type="text/css">body {width: 100%;} </style>
<body OnLoad="window.print()" OnFocus="window.close()">
<?php
include "../konmysqli.php";
echo"<link href='../ypathcss/$css' rel='stylesheet' type='text/css' />";
$YPATH="../ypathfile";

$pk="";
$field="status";
$TB="$tbadmin";
$item="Admin";

$sql="select * from `$TB` order by `$field` asc";
if(isset($_GET["pk"])){
    $pk=$_GET["pk"];
     $sql="select * from `$TB` where `$field` ='$pk' order by `$field` asc";
}
?>


<h3><center>Laporan Data <?php echo $item;?> <?php echo ($pk);?></h3>


<table width="98%" border="0">
  <tr>
   <th width="3%">No</td>
      <th width="5%">IDAdmin</td>
    <th width="46%">Nama Admin</td>
    <th width="15%">Telepon</td>
    <th width="18%">Email</td>
    <th width="12%">Keterangan</td>
  </tr>
<?php 

  $jum=getJum($conn,$sql);
  $no=0;
        if($jum > 0){
    $arr=getData($conn,$sql);
        foreach($arr as $d) {                               
        $no++;
            $id_admin=$d["id_admin"];
                $nama_admin=strtoupper($d["nama_admin"]);
                $email=$d["email"];
                $telepon=$d["telepon"];
                $username=$d["username"];
                $password=$d["password"];
                $status=$d["status"];
                $keterangan=$d["keterangan"];
                $color="#dddddd";       
                    if($no %2==0){$color="#eeeeee";}
echo"<tr bgcolor='$color'>
                <td>$no</td>
                <td>$id_admin</td>
                <td><b>$nama_admin</b>
                <td>$telepon</td>
                <td>$email</td>
                <td>$keterangan</td>
                </tr>";
               
            }//while
        }//if
        else{echo"<tr><td colspan='7'><blink>Maaf, Data $item Belum Tersedia...</blink></td></tr>";}
       
/*+++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++*/

function getJum($conn,$sql){
  $rs=$conn->query($sql);
  $jum= $rs->num_rows;
    $rs->free();
    return $jum;
}

function getData($conn,$sql){
    $rs=$conn->query($sql);
    $rs->data_seek(0);
    $arr = $rs->fetch_all(MYSQLI_ASSOC);
   
    $rs->free();
    return $arr;
}
       
?>

</table>

Posting Komentar untuk "Tutorial Cara Membuat Print Preview PHP & Mysql Pada MasterCSS"